The Kansas Public Employees Retirement System (KPERS), located in Topeka, is more than a pension system — we're a people-focused organization committed to supporting Kansas public employees throughout their careers and into retirement. We provide disability, death, and lifetime retirement benefits that protect those who dedicate their work to serving the public.

The Deputy Chief Information Officer (Deputy CIO) serves as the second-in-command to the Chief Information Officer and leads the day-to-day execution and operational performance of the Information Technology organization. This position serves as a trusted advisor to executive leadership by providing clear communication regarding technology performance, operational readiness, service quality, and organizational risk.
Working in close partnership with the CIO, the Deputy CIO translates strategic priorities into operational execution—ensuring technology investments align with business needs while maintaining operational stability across both legacy and modern platforms.

Qualifications and Requirements
Ten or more years of progressively responsible experience in information technology with at least five years of management responsibilities providing infrastructure, security, and disaster recovery for information technology systems. A bachelor's degree in computer science, information systems, business administration or related field may be substituted for four years of required experience in information technology. A master's degree in computer science, information systems, business administration or related field may be substituted for two years of required management experience.
Additionally, candidates should have the following skills and abilities:
Operational Leadership : Proven ability to run IT operations with accountability for performance, reliability, and service delivery. Commitment to excellent customer service.
Service Management Expertise : Strong understanding of ITSM practices and performance-based service delivery models
Technology Oversight : Broad knowledge of infrastructure, applications, cloud platforms, and enterprise systems sufficient to guide teams and vendors
DevOps & Delivery Awareness: Understanding of modern delivery practices, including CI/CD, release management, and environment governance
Security & Risk Awareness: Knowledge of cybersecurity practices, risk management, and regulatory compliance requirements
Vendor Management : Ability to hold vendors accountable and ensure transparency in delivery and performance
Business Alignment : Strong business acumen with the ability to align IT services to organizational needs
Financial Management : Experience managing budgets, optimizing costs, and aligning resources to priorities
Communication & Influence: Ability to clearly communicate technical and operational information to executive and non-technical audiences
Analytical & Problem Solving: Strong critical thinking skills with the ability to assess risk, identify issues, and drive resolution
Relationship Development : Ability to maintain positive working relationships with a diverse group of people and to work effectively within a team. Strong commitment to excellent customer service.
